Under a nitrogen atmosphere, sodium methoxide (170.1 g., 3.15 moles, 2.1 equiv.) was dissolved in 2.7 1. of absolute ethanol, and the stirred solution cooled in an ice bath. Solid 4-picolyl chloride hydrochloride (97%, 253.6 g., 1.5 moles, 1 equiv.) was added portionwise over approximately 15 minutes. A solution of 2-mercaptoethanol (128.9 g., 1.65 moles), dissolved in 300 ml. of ethanol, was then added dropwise over approximately 30 minutes. The reaction was allowed to warm to room temperature and stirred for 21.5 hours. Diatomaceous earth was added to the reaction mixture, which after brief stirring, was filtered. The filter cake was repulped 2× 1500 ml. of absolute ethanol, the filtrates were combined with the original filtrate, and the combined ethanol solution evaporated to a solid-containing oil (approximately 290 g.). The oil was dissolved in 1500 ml. of hot chloroform, treated with activated carbon, filtered, reconcentrated to oil (274 g.) and chromatographed on 1.5 kg. of silcia gel in a 10 cm. diameter column using chloroform as eluant. Fractions of approximately 3.5 1. were taken. Fractions 3 to 18 were combined, concentrated to oil, the oil taken up in approximately 1 1. of ethyl acetate and evaporated to yield relatively pure 4-(2-hydroxyethylthiomethyl)pyridine [195.7 g., ir (film): 3.17, 3.51, 3.58, 6.27, 9.45 and 12.27μ; pnmr/CDCl3 /TMS/delta: 8.63-8.42 (m, 2H), 7.38-7.18 (m, 2H), 3.73 (t, 2H), 3.72 (s, 2H), 2.98 (s, broad, 1H) and 2.63 (t, 2H) ppm]. On standing, product prepared by this procedure slowly crystallized (m.p. 47°-48° C.).
